Making a release
|
|
------------------
|
|
For more information see https://github.com/scikit-learn/scikit-learn/wiki/How-to-make-a-release
|
|
|
|
|
|
1. Update docs:
|
|
|
|
- Edit the doc/whats_new.rst file to add release title and commit
|
|
statistics. You can retrieve commit statistics with::
|
|
|
|
$ git shortlog -ns 0.998..
|
|
|
|
- Edit the doc/index.rst to change the 'News' entry of the front page.
|
|
|
|
2. Update the version number in sklearn/__init__.py, the __version__
|
|
variable
|
|
|
|
3. Create the tag and push it::
|
|
|
|
$ git tag 0.999
|
|
|
|
$ git push origin --tags
|
|
|
|
4. create tarballs:
|
|
|
|
- Wipe clean your repo::
|
|
|
|
$ git clean -xfd
|
|
|
|
- Register and upload on PyPI::
|
|
|
|
$ python setup.py sdist register upload
|
|
|
|
|
|
5. Push the documentation to the website. Circle CI should do this
|
|
automatically for master and <N>.<N>.X branches.
|
|
|
|
6. Build binaries using dedicated CI servers by updating the git submodule
|
|
reference to the new scikit-learn tag of the release at:
|
|
|
|
https://github.com/MacPython/scikit-learn-wheels
|
|
|
|
Once the CI has completed successfully, collect the generated binary wheel
|
|
packages and upload them to PyPI by running the following commands in the
|
|
scikit-learn source folder (checked out at the release tag)::
|
|
|
|
$ pip install -U wheelhouse_uploader
|
|
$ python setup.py sdist fetch_artifacts upload_all
|
|
|
|
|
|
7. FOR FINAL RELEASE: Update the release date in What's New

The scikit-learn.org web site
|
|
-----------------------------
|
|
|
|
The scikit-learn web site (http://scikit-learn.org) is hosted at GitHub,
|
|
but should rarely be updated manually by pushing to the
|
|
https://github.com/scikit-learn/scikit-learn.github.io repository. Most
|
|
updates can be made by pushing to master (for /dev) or a release branch
|
|
like 0.99.X, from which Circle CI builds and uploads the documentation
|
|
automatically.

Travis Cron jobs
|
|
----------------
|
|
|
|
From `<https://docs.travis-ci.com/user/cron-jobs>`_: Travis CI cron jobs work
|
|
similarly to the cron utility, they run builds at regular scheduled intervals
|
|
independently of whether any commits were pushed to the repository. Cron jobs
|
|
always fetch the most recent commit on a particular branch and build the project
|
|
at that state. Cron jobs can run daily, weekly or monthly, which in practice
|
|
means up to an hour after the selected time span, and you cannot set them to run
|
|
at a specific time.
|
|
|
|
For scikit-learn, Cron jobs are used for builds that we do not want to run in
|
|
each PR. As an example the build with the dev versions of numpy and scipy is
|
|
run as a Cron job. Most of the time when this numpy-dev build fail, it is
|
|
related to a numpy change and not a scikit-learn one, so it would not make sense
|
|
to blame the PR author for the Travis failure.
|
|
|
|
The definition of what gets run in the Cron job is done in the .travis.yml
|
|
config file, exactly the same way as the other Travis jobs. We use a ``if: type
|
|
= cron`` filter in order for the build to be run only in Cron jobs.
|
|
|
|
The branch targeted by the Cron job and the frequency of the Cron job is set
|
|
via the web UI at https://www.travis-ci.org/scikit-learn/scikit-learn/settings.
